The specialty coffee industry faces unprecedented pressure from rising minimum wages, high turnover rates (often exceeding 150% annually in fast-casual food service), and inconsistent human training. Leading enterprise hospitality groups are shifting toward robotic automation manufacturers to guarantee operational continuity without sacrificing extraction quality.
Traditional cafes suffer from restricted operating hours due to labor constraints. Robotic coffee kiosks—equipped with internal cleaning circuits and multi-payment gateways—enable commercial real estate developers, transit hubs, and hospital complexes to turn idle square footage into continuous revenue-generating nodes 24 hours a day, 365 days a year.
Human baristas naturally introduce variance in tamping force, milk frothing microfoam textures, and grind calibrations. Custom robotic coffee machines integrate closed-loop feedback sensor arrays that control water temperature (+/-0.5°C), brew pressure, and mechanical dosing down to the milligram, delivering uniform master-level beverages.

Inside the engineering innovations powering OEM custom robotic coffee manufacturing: From precision actuators to Vision-AI modules.
Our custom coffee robotic solutions feature high-torque harmonic drive reducers and absolute optical encoders. With repeatability tolerances down to ±0.02mm, the robotic arm smoothly transitions between bean grinding, portafilter tamping, steam wand manipulation, cup lid sealing, and client delivery windows without mechanical jitter.
Integrated overhead cameras coupled with neural network image processing analyze milk microfoam density in real-time. The arm executes complex 2D and 3D latte art patterns (rosettas, tulips, customized corporate logos) while dynamically adjusting pouring angle and elevation relative to the liquid surface height.
Every kiosk transmits over 50 telemetry datapoints per second to a centralized dashboard. Operators monitor bean hopper mass, water filtration total dissolved solids (TDS), syrup pump pressures, and refrigeration temperatures. Automated predictive maintenance alerts technicians prior to component failure.
Equipped with dual-stage UV-C sterilization chambers and pressurized hot-water CIP (Clean-in-Place) circuits. Milk tubing lines undergo automatic ozone-water flushes every 30 minutes, ensuring strict compliance with FDA, EU CE, and HACCP commercial sanitation standards.
